Overview of the Eaton 5S1500LCD

The Eaton 5S1500LCD is a premium UPS designed to provide backup power and surge protection. It features a user-friendly LCD display that shows vital information such as battery status, load level, and estimated runtime. Its power capacity of 1500VA/900W makes it suitable for protecting multiple devices simultaneously.

Key Features for Sensitive Electronics

  • Pure Sine Wave Output: The UPS provides a clean power output, which is essential for sensitive electronics that require stable power.
  • Line-Interactive Design: It manages power fluctuations effectively, reducing the risk of damage from surges and brownouts.
  • Automatic Voltage Regulation (AVR): Ensures consistent voltage levels, protecting devices from voltage spikes and dips.
  • Battery Management: The LCD display offers real-time battery health monitoring, aiding in maintenance and replacement decisions.
  • Multiple Outlets: It includes several surge-protected outlets, allowing for comprehensive protection of connected devices.

Limitations and Considerations

While the Eaton 5S1500LCD offers many benefits, there are some limitations to consider. Its capacity, although substantial, may not be sufficient for very high-power equipment or large server setups. Also, the UPS is primarily designed for backup power and surge protection, not for continuous power supply in critical environments that require uninterruptible operation.

Furthermore, regular maintenance and battery replacement are essential to ensure ongoing protection. Users should monitor the LCD display for battery health updates and replace batteries as recommended by Eaton.
